This workshop focuses on the research of contemporary visual culture and the issues raised by various visual practices. How are we supposed to decipher the codes of the images flooding our surroundings, which often do not originate from art, but from media and technology, and
address different aspects of social life? On the other hand, how are we supposed to read the messages of those images or things that were produced for non-artistic purposes or using aesthetic forms, hiding the ideas that gave birth to them in the demands of everyday life? These
are the type of questions that can drive researches which in turn references the following theoretical frameworks:

a) Visual culture,
b) Image and text theories,
c) Visual symbolism,
d) Cultural studies, media studies.
